This is pizza cote d’azur style. Emmentaler is more likely used than mozzarella. The crust is impossibly thin. You eat with a knife and fork. A trick is to fold the edges in as soon as you get it as Le Collier’s pizzas are wider than my shoulders and bigger than any plate. Eat it while it is hot!
This place is fantastic and again, you will not believe how thin they get the crust. It is remarkable.
On that note, they do have take-away but don’t. At least once have it just as it comes out of the oven.
At night this place is boisterous with extended families, people on dates and guys at the bar. Like a french version of the local Scottish pub.
